#bfb300 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#bfb300 is composed of 74.9% red, 70.2%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 6.3% magenta, 100% yellow and 25.1% black. It has a hue angle of 56.2 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 37.5%. #bfb300 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ff00 with #7f6700. Closest websafe color is: #cccc00.

#bfb300 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#bfb300 has RGB values of R:191, G:179, B:0 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.06, Y:1, K:0.25. Its decimal value is 12563200.
